Transaction 13c042bad368ac3359713866c1224ea0cf92f6c48542cc86e5dd42323f2eb8ac
1 Input
1 Output
-
13c042bad368ac3359713866c1224ea0cf92f6c48542cc86e5dd42323f2eb8ac:0
- value
- 75926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5fb236acb530871ae53502f1fd628964af36d5e OP_EQUAL
- address
- 3MCShoU7tyXC1GQ43eaWTQ3uzZtdw67Du1